ChatGPT Integration in WhatsApp Now Supports Images and Voice Messages

OpenAI has expanded the integration of ChatGPT with WhatsApp, allowing users to interact with the AI chatbot through images and voice messages. Initially announced in December, this feature enables users to communicate with ChatGPT by starting a chat with the phone number 1-800-242-8478. This update aims to make ChatGPT more accessible, even for those without the app installed or an internet connection, as OpenAI also launched a ChatGPT phone line in December.

New Features and Future Plans

In addition to text-based conversations, the new integration supports image uploads and voice messages, enhancing user interaction. OpenAI is also working on linking OpenAI accounts with WhatsApp, which will be available soon for Free, Plus, and Pro users. The ChatGPT app is free on the iOS App Store, with a Mac version available on the OpenAI website.
